Responsibilities

Conduct unarmed patrols on foot or vehicle throughout hospital grounds; document observations of unusual conditions that may create security concerns or safety hazards.

Assist hospital staff with de‑escalation of situations involving patients; restrain combative individuals as necessary within company guidelines.

Transport patients to the morgue and escort patients from the helicopter pad to the emergency room when required.

Assist with evacuations during fires, medical emergencies, and natural disasters.

Sound alarms and call police or fire department if fire or presence of unauthorized persons is detected.

Warn violators of rule infractions, such as loitering, smoking, or carrying prohibited articles.

Permit authorized persons to enter property and monitor entrances and exits; ensure only authorized individuals enter and that no contraband or hospital items are brought in or out.

Observe departing personnel to protect against theft of company property and ensure that authorized removal of property is conducted within appropriate client requirements.

Investigate and prepare reports on accidents, incidents, and suspicious activities; maintain written logs as required.
